Title: Innovations by Bidyut De

Introduction

Bidyut De is a notable inventor based in Faridabad, India. He has made significant contributions to the field of hydrocarbon processing, holding a total of 4 patents. His work focuses on enhancing the efficiency of catalytic cracking processes, which are crucial in the production of valuable petrochemical products.

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"Production of propylene in a fluid catalytic cracking unit." This invention discloses a process and apparatus for catalytic cracking of hydrocarbon feedstock using a circulating fluidized bed reactor-regenerator configuration. The design aims to maximize the yield of propylene (C3 olefin). The apparatus features two reaction zones that operate under different temperatures and weight hourly space velocities (WHSV). The primary zone is dedicated to cracking hydrocarbon feedstock, while the secondary zone focuses on cracking the C4 fraction produced in the primary zone. This innovative approach selectively promotes oligomerization of the C4 fraction before it is cracked to produce C3 olefin.

Another significant patent by Bidyut De is "FCC feed injector with improved atomization." This invention presents a method and apparatus for effectively mixing and atomizing a hydrocarbon stream using a diluent or dispersion stream. The apparatus consists of concentric inner and outer conduits that define an annular space. The design includes a diluent/dispersion stream distributor with orifices that direct portions of the dispersion stream into the annular space and inner conduit, enhancing the mixing process.
